The Petition custody form with court in Orange is a legal document designed for individuals seeking a writ of habeas corpus, specifically addressing issues related to their custody and mental health status. This form is particularly valuable for users who are petitioning for relief from convictions under U.S. law, allowing them to outline grievances related to their legal representation and mental health evaluations during their trial. Key features of the form include detailed sections for user information, grounds for relief, and affidavits supporting the petitioner's claims. It also requires clear documentation regarding any legal representation and the nature of the convicted offense. Filling and editing instructions emphasize the need for accuracy and thoroughness, advising users to ensure all sections are completed with correct names, dates, and relevant legal citations. Attorneys, paralegals, and legal assistants can assist users in navigating this form, ensuring it meets the necessary legal standards for submission to the Orange County court. This form is particularly useful for those who have experienced issues with effective counsel, such as not receiving adequate psychiatric evaluation or understanding their guilty pleas. The document ultimately aims to secure an evidentiary hearing or a transfer to an appropriate mental health facility for individuals whose mental health needs may not be met in a correctional setting.

The Summons (FL-210) explains what you can do. You can respond by filing a Response (form FL-220) in court. If you don't file a Response within 30 days of getting these papers, the Petitioner can ask the court to decide the case without your input. This is called a default.

To get or change a court order for custody or visitation, you must file forms at the Clerk's Office at the Lamoreaux Justice Center. The forms you need depend on your situation. Generally, if you already have an existing case opened, then you may file paperwork to set the matter for a hearing.

In Conclusion Fathers have an equal chance of obtaining 50/50 custody in California, as custody decisions are not based on the gender of the parent. Instead, various factors are taken into consideration, such as: The child's age and health. The quality of the relationship between the child and each parent.

A: When you file for child or spousal support in California, the time it takes to receive temporary support depends on how soon a court hearing is scheduled. After you file your request, the court typically sets a hearing within a few weeks to a few months.

When Can A Child Decide Which Parent To Live With In California? In California, a child's preference in custody matters is not the only factor considered by the court, but children aged 14 and above can express their parental preference to aid in determining custody.

Filing for a Child Custody Modification in California Obtain the required forms, such as the FL-300, also known as the "Request for Order." Fill out this form with details of the requested change. Make copies of the forms. Make two copies of the completed forms.
